Bird Swarm Algoritms with Chaotic Mapping Optimization known as also mathematical programming, is a collection of processes that select the most appropriate values of decision variables according to a goal (evaluation) function. Many algorithms have been proposed for optimization problems. Most of these algorithms need mathematical models for model of system and objective function. General purposed heuristic optimization algorithms are used in order to obtain the solution in reasonable time when mathematical models cannot be derived. General purposed heuristic optimization algorithms are evaluated in eight different groups including biology-based, physics-based, swarm-based, social-based, music-based, chemistry-based, sports based, and mathematics based. Swarm intelligence based optimization algorithms have been developed by observing the movements of live swarms such as bird, fish, cat, and bee. In order to increase the fast convergence and high accuracy of the optimization algorithms, chaotic maps have been used in many algorithms. Bird Swarm Algorithm (BSA) is one of the most recent swarm based algorithms. This is the first time chaos has been introduced to increase the global convergence feature and prevent from being stuck in the local solution of BSA. In this thesis, BSA and chaotic BSA were studied in detail and the performances of the algorithms have been tested on unimodal and multi modal benchmark functions with different dimensions and three constrained real-life problem. In these investigations, tendency of converging to optimum is used as a measure of performance. Experimental results have been presented and interpreted through comparative tables and graphs. It is expected that this algorithm will be efficiently used in many different types of complex problems due to high performance of the algorithm in both unimodal and multi modal functions.
